My NX's mods

I have been offline for sometime now and now that I am back a lot of people have been asking about my car. Yes it doesn't run right now but it will by summer. And it will hit low 12's if not high 11's when it is done. Anyway here is what I have done. First I'll give the N/A setup since that is what I get asked about being it was fast N/A. Then I will tell what I have done since I tore it down.

93 NX2000 Sapphire Blue, no power options other than mirrors,
gutted to 2241 lbs.
battery in a box inside,
celica shift knob, cut and re welded shifter,
Reverse fog light,
ES bushings throughout,
JWT mounts,
JWT PP, 2000 se disc,
welded trans case,
Brembo rotors,
metal master pads,
AGX shocks,
Suspension Tech springs I have sentra and NX springs I put the sentra springs on for drag since it drops the front another 1/2", NX springs for autox,
1/4" wheel spacers for drag and classic wheels with M/T ET drags 20x6x14, Azenis on NX wheels, Daytonas on escort wheels,
JDM SR20DE,
HS CAI,
ported MAF
ported TB,
ported IM,
PS header port matched ( all porting done by me and my dremel),
best times ran on open header, but also an 2.5" exhaust ,
no cat,
HKS step 1 intake cam 264* 10.5mm lift,
outlaw engineering prototype spacers( testing was done on my car)
UR pulleys,
no water pump or PS or ac,
12v water pump( with rheostat to adj voltage to control speed and flow, performance radiator 3 row,
300zx rad cap,no T stat,
homemade adj fpr,
slim push fan,
300zx fuel filter,
homemade front lip,
8gauge ground wires,
FSTB,
clifford alarm
no front sway bar for drag
Advanced timing to 20*

I think that was all it has been a while

turbo setup
S13 mani,
S13 T25,
HKS style S13 split J pipe dumping out of the car there.
home made intake,
homemade IC piping
BB tmic
1st gen DSM bov
JGY oil water lines,
370cc inj
walbro 255lph


G20
JDM intake cam
timing to 19
ghetto intake
rstb
brembo rotors, metal master pads
bronze wheels, nitto 465's
tinted tails,

If I think of anything else I will add it
